Summary:Gender is defined as the social construction of differences in the roles,functions and responsibilities between women and men resulting from socio-cultural construction and may change according to the times,conditions,time, place and culture, as well as the change of values shared by the community. Thus, gender is not something that is universal but is formed in accordance with the values espoused by the subculture of society.Based on the Minister of National Education Regulation no.84 year 2008 on Guidelines for Mainstreaming Gender Education Sector explained that Gender is a concept that refers to the division of roles and responsibilities of men and women that is the result of changing social and cultural conditions of society.
